Within-city ZIP comparison
Where the ZIP codes inside Salisbury differ
The published income range is comparatively compact across the ZIPs in Salisbury: $71,313 in ZIP 21801 to $73,156 in 21804. The city average is therefore a more representative summary here, though each ZIP page still carries its own housing and demographic record.

Census ZBP business roll-up
Employer-heavy short list in Salisbury
Citywide ZBP: 1,991 establishments, 31,564 employees , annual payroll $1,683,986k (~29 establishments per 1,000 residents) across 3 of 3 ZIPs. Peak business ZIP 21801 (1,141 units) ; leading NAICS Health care and social assistance (321) · also Retail trade · Other services (except public administration) .
